Northrop Grumman Space Systems is seeking an Principal Electrical Engineer to work within the Radar Integrated Product Team (IPT) of the Deep Space Advanced Radar Capability (DARC) Site 2 program (DS2). The Radar IPT is responsible for the design, development and integration of the major RF and Analog Subsystems / Components of the DS2 System. This role will be reporting to the DS2 Radar IPT lead and working collaboratively with team members of the RADAR IPT through the major design (i.e., SRR, PDR, CDR) and integration milestone (integration point testing, assembly, checkout). The ideal candidate should have a strong foundational knowledge in the development lifecycle and experience with ground-based sensor exploitation or radar systems.
